busca
Page 1 the 613.000.000 Web results (0.1003 seg.)
Searches related to
Is There A Niagara Falls In Canada
Niagara Falls Canada
University Of Niagara Falls Canada
Niagara Falls Canada Hotels
Embassy Suites Niagara Falls Canada
Things To Do In Niagara Falls Canada
Hilton Niagara Falls Canada
WEB RESULTS
Searches related to
Is There A Niagara Falls In Canada
Niagara Falls Canada
University Of Niagara Falls Canada
Niagara Falls Canada Hotels
Embassy Suites Niagara Falls Canada
Things To Do In Niagara Falls Canada
Hilton Niagara Falls Canada
1
2
3
4
5
Next
>